Emplois

Jenkins limite les travaux parallèles

Jenkins limite les travaux parallèles
  1. Jenkins peut-il exécuter plusieurs travaux simultanément?
  2. Jenkins peut-il exécuter des travaux en parallèle?
  3. Combien d'emplois nous pouvons gérer à Jenkins?
  4. Combien d'emplois peuvent fonctionner simultanément?
  5. Est-il possible d'avoir plusieurs travaux à la fois?
  6. Combien d'emplois peuvent être exécutés en parallèle dans le système?
  7. Comment exécuter deux travaux séquentiellement dans Jenkins?
  8. Pourquoi est-il préférable d'exécuter plusieurs travaux en parallèle versus séquentiellement?
  9. Le travail unique des Jenkins peut fonctionner sur plusieurs nœuds?
  10. Comment définir l'exécution parallèle dans Jenkins?
  11. Quelles sont les limites de Jenkins?
  12. Pourquoi Jenkins est obsolète?
  13. Quelles sont les restrictions d'emploi?
  14. Comment exécuter deux travaux séquentiellement dans Jenkins?
  15. Comment exécuter un travail de Jenkins simultanément?
  16. Comment déclencher tous les travaux de Jenkins à la fois?
  17. Comment planifier plusieurs emplois dans Jenkins?
  18. Ce qui est utilisé pour exécuter plusieurs travaux en parallèle?
  19. Pouvons-nous exécuter plusieurs pipelines à Jenkins?
  20. Pouvons-nous avoir deux maîtres à Jenkins?

Jenkins peut-il exécuter plusieurs travaux simultanément?

Lors de la création de nouveaux emplois Jenkins, vous aurez une option pour créer un projet multijob. Dans la section Build, ce travail peut définir des phases qui contiennent un ou plusieurs emplois. Tous les travaux qui appartiennent à une phase seront exécutés en parallèle (s'il y a suffisamment d'exécuteurs sur le nœud)

Jenkins peut-il exécuter des travaux en parallèle?

Exécution parallèle du travail à Jenkins

Dans Jenkins, il existe plusieurs façons de mettre en œuvre une exécution parallèle. L'une des approches communes est le modèle de construction parent-enfant. Dans ce modèle - un travail parent (en amont) déclenche des emplois pour enfants (en aval).

Combien d'emplois nous pouvons gérer à Jenkins?

Ces équations supposent que le contrôleur Jenkins aura 5 cœurs avec un noyau pour 100 emplois (500 emplois totaux / contrôleur) et que les équipes seront divisées en groupes de 40.

Combien d'emplois peuvent fonctionner simultanément?

Un nombre de travaux - le nombre n'est limité que par le CPU et la mémoire - peut être exécuté simultanément et - s'ils ont été configurés pour le faire - être exécuté dans plusieurs processus.

Est-il possible d'avoir plusieurs travaux à la fois?

Est-il légal de travailler 2 emplois en même temps? Il n'est pas illégal de occuper 2 emplois en même temps, mais il peut être violée de toute règle de travail, par exemple, de nombreux contrats de travail interdisent aux employés d'entreprendre toute activité qui pourrait créer un conflit d'intérêts.

Combien d'emplois peuvent être exécutés en parallèle dans le système?

Cela dépend totalement du travail que vous utilisez. Dites par exemple si c'est un travail complexe qui nécessite un minimum de 6 Go de RAM, vous pouvez exécuter 6 travaux en parallèle.

Comment exécuter deux travaux séquentiellement dans Jenkins?

De nombreuses «phases» peuvent être configurées dans le cadre du projet multijob et chaque phase "contient" un ou plusieurs "autres emplois Jenkins. Lorsque le projet multijob est exécuté, les phases seront exécutées séquentiellement. Par conséquent, afin d'exécuter des travaux de travail séquentiellement, ajoutez n phases à votre projet multijob, puis ajoutez un travail à chaque phase.

Pourquoi est-il préférable d'exécuter plusieurs travaux en parallèle versus séquentiellement?

Vous pouvez profiter encore mieux du cluster lorsque vous exécutez vos travaux en parallèle que en série. De cette façon, vous pouvez exécuter beaucoup plus de tâches à la fois (simultanément) et obtenir un résultat plus rapide. L'image ci-dessus illustre comment une tâche est exécutée en série par un seul processeur.

Le travail unique des Jenkins peut fonctionner sur plusieurs nœuds?

Enregistrez la configuration du travail et créez le travail en fonction de vos besoins. Étape 1− Si la sélection de plusieurs nœuds a été activée, vous avez la possibilité de sélectionner plusieurs nœuds pour exécuter le travail sur. Le travail sera ensuite exécuté sur chacun des nœuds, l'un après l'autre ou simultané - selon la configuration.

Comment définir l'exécution parallèle dans Jenkins?

Ce plugin ajoute un outil qui vous permet d'exécuter facilement des tests en parallèle. Ceci est réalisé en demandant à Jenkins de regarder le temps d'exécution du test de la dernière exécution, diviser les tests en plusieurs unités de taille à peu près égale, puis les exécuter en parallèle.

Quelles sont les limites de Jenkins?

Voici quelques inconvénients de Jenkins: Architecture de serveur unique - utilise une architecture de serveur unique, qui limite les ressources aux ressources sur un seul ordinateur, une machine virtuelle ou un conteneur. Jenkins n'autorise pas la fédération du serveur à serveur, qui peut entraîner des problèmes de performances dans des environnements à grande échelle.

Pourquoi Jenkins est obsolète?

Beaucoup de plugins Jenkins ne sont pas entretenus et sont devenus redondants. Cela cause des problèmes de compatibilité avec le nouveau style de pipeline déclaratif. Comme Jenkins vieillit, sa conception et son interface utilisateur ne sont pas non plus à jour. L'interface utilisateur de Jenkins n'est pas non plus très sympathique.

Quelles sont les restrictions d'emploi?

Restrictions d'emploi pour les projets

Ce type de restrictions permet d'empêcher l'exécution des travaux par la cause de lancement. Si la cause ne satisfait pas aux exigences, le travail échoue avant l'exécution de SCM (le travail ne peut pas être interdit en raison de Jenkins-19497).

Comment exécuter deux travaux séquentiellement dans Jenkins?

De nombreuses «phases» peuvent être configurées dans le cadre du projet multijob et chaque phase "contient" un ou plusieurs "autres emplois Jenkins. Lorsque le projet multijob est exécuté, les phases seront exécutées séquentiellement. Par conséquent, afin d'exécuter des travaux de travail séquentiellement, ajoutez n phases à votre projet multijob, puis ajoutez un travail à chaque phase.

Comment exécuter un travail de Jenkins simultanément?

Jenkins permet une exécution parallèle des versions pour un emploi. La page de configuration du travail a une case à cocher, "Exécuter des versions simultanées si nécessaire". De plus, dans la configuration du nœud maître, définissez le champ "# des exécuteurs" sur plus de 1. Une fois ces deux terminés, l'exécution de travaux parallèles est activée.

Comment déclencher tous les travaux de Jenkins à la fois?

Utiliser le plugin de déclenchement paramétré. Lorsque vous spécifiez des travaux à appeler dans le plugin, vous pouvez utiliser des jetons, comme dans le travail _ $ param1 _ $ param2 . Enregistrer cette réponse.

Comment planifier plusieurs emplois dans Jenkins?

Syntaxe de planification de l'emploi Jenkins

Vous pouvez planifier un emploi pour plus d'une fois en ajoutant plus d'une entrée. Chaque champ peut contenir une valeur exacte ou utiliser un ensemble d'expressions spéciales: l'astérisque familier * indique toutes les valeurs valides. Donc, un travail qui fonctionne tous les jours a un * dans le troisième champ.

Ce qui est utilisé pour exécuter plusieurs travaux en parallèle?

Réponses. Comme nous le savons tous, Talend est également appelé un générateur de code Java, il est conçu pour exécuter divers travaux et sous-emplois dans plusieurs threads en même temps pour enregistrer le temps d'exécution d'un travail.

Pouvons-nous exécuter plusieurs pipelines à Jenkins?

Création de pipelines multi-branches. Le type de projet de pipeline multibranch vous permet de configurer différents travaux pour différentes branches du même projet. Dans une configuration de pipeline multi-branchage, Jenkins découvre, gère et exécute automatiquement des travaux pour plusieurs référentiels et succursales source.

Pouvons-nous avoir deux maîtres à Jenkins?

Le deuxième niveau est la configuration de Jenkins Master dans laquelle les deux maîtres ont la même configuration et partagent Jenkins à domicile pour la haute disponibilité. Ainsi, le projet créé sur un maître Jenkins sera également disponible pour le deuxième maître une fois la configuration rechargée.

Github Sous-Soupree Fusiter Demandes
Qu'est-ce que le sous-arbre fusionne?Comment fusionner les demandes dans github?Quelle est la différence entre le sous-arbre et le sous-module dans g...
Est-il possible de lire l'adresse IP DNS de Resolv.confie avec dans AWS ECS Container et utilisez au démarrage du serveur?
Quelle est l'adresse IP du serveur AWS DNS?Fargate a-t-il une adresse IP?Quel est le mode de réseautage par défaut dans ECS?Est-ce que ECS a des espa...
Séparation appropriée de l'IAC et du déploiement du code via CI / CD
Quelle est la différence entre IAC et CI CD?Qu'est-ce que CI CD et l'infrastructure en tant que technologies de code?Qu'est-ce que le pipeline IAC?Qu...